Output 76ddbbe018109247f456b8ba81afbc0357f69d5883eda5da6db0fc93f2a1b073:0

value
2981971
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 916ad18dc44a74e8908fc6852ab6b0665b789b74 OP_EQUALVERIFY OP_CHECKSIG
address
1EFtwhath2r8hHHHKoqxTh4z4uAh47zH9M
transaction
76ddbbe018109247f456b8ba81afbc0357f69d5883eda5da6db0fc93f2a1b073
spent
true